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Commits on Sep 7, 2005
  1. GIT 0.99.6

    Junio C Hamano authored
  2. @dkagedal

    [PATCH] Simplify git script

    dkagedal authored Junio C Hamano committed
    The code for listing the available subcommands was unnecessarily
    complex.
    
    Signed-off-by: David K�gedal <davidk@lysator.liu.se>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  3. Documentation updates.

    Junio C Hamano authored
    More commands are documented now; thanks Raymond.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  4. @gitzilla

    [PATCH] Docs for git-build-rev-cache.

    gitzilla authored Junio C Hamano committed
    Signed-off-by: A Large Angry SCM <gitzilla@gmail.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  5. @gitzilla

    [PATCH] Docs for git-show-rev-cache.

    gitzilla authored Junio C Hamano committed
    Signed-off-by: A Large Angry SCM <gitzilla@gmail.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  6. @gitzilla

    [PATCH] Docs for git-reset-script.

    gitzilla authored Junio C Hamano committed
    Signed-off-by: A Large Angry SCM <gitzilla@gmail.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  7. @gitzilla

    [PATCH] Docs for git-checkout-script.

    gitzilla authored Junio C Hamano committed
    Signed-off-by: A Large Angry SCM <gitzilla@gmail.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  8. Documentation updates.

    Junio C Hamano authored
    parse-remote and rev-parse gets full documentation.  Add skeleton for
    archimport.  Link them from the main git(7) page.  Also move git-daemon
    and git-request-pull out of 'undocumented' section.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  9. Flatten tools/ directory to make build procedure simpler.

    Junio C Hamano authored
    Also make platform specific part more isolated.  Currently we only
    have Darwin defined, but I've taken a look at SunOS specific patch
    (which I dropped on the floor for now) as well.  Doing things this way
    would make adding it easier.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Commits on Sep 6, 2005
  1. mailinfo: barf and exist upon nested multipart.

    Junio C Hamano authored
    At least we can detect what we do not handle.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  2. Merge branch 'master' of .

    Junio C Hamano authored
  3. [PATCH] Update documentation for git-get-tar-commit-id

    Rene Scharfe authored Junio C Hamano committed
    ... and add a copyright notice.
    
    [jc: also move its entry in git.txt from undocumented section.]
    
    Signed-off-by: Rene Scharfe <rene.scharfe@lsrfire.ath.cx>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  4. [PATCH] git-cvsimport-script: handling of tags

    H. Peter Anvin authored Junio C Hamano committed
    This patch changes git-cvsimport-script so that it creates tag objects
    instead of refs to commits, and adds an option, -u, to convert
    underscores in branch and tag names to dots (since CVS doesn't allow
    dots in branches and tags.)
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  5. Format fix for asciidoc documentation titles.

    Junio C Hamano authored
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Commits on Sep 5, 2005
  1. Merge branch 'master' of .

    Junio C Hamano authored
  2. Retire git-clone-dumb-http.

    Junio C Hamano authored
    ... and fold it into git-clone-script.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  3. @pugmajere

    [PATCH] Update documentation of --compose to git-send-email-script.txt

    pugmajere authored Junio C Hamano committed
    Signed-off-by: Ryan Anderson <ryan@michonline.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  4. @pugmajere

    [PATCH] Make git-send-email-script ignore some unnecessary options wh…

    pugmajere authored Junio C Hamano committed
    …en operating in batch mode.
    
    Add a "--compose" option that uses $EDITOR to edit an "introductory" email to the patch series.
    
    Signed-off-by: Ryan Anderson <ryan@michonline.com>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  5. Install archimport-script.

    Junio C Hamano authored
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Commits on Sep 4, 2005
  1. Merge branch 'master' of .

    Junio C Hamano authored
  2. Add copy/rename check for git-apply.

    Junio C Hamano authored
    The new test pattern is taken from HPA's klibc and klibc-kbuild trees,
    which has many interesting renames (the commits
    001eef5a19219e5b0601068a3d13874b88c0653e and
    0037d1bc0deaf7daec3778496656cb04b4e4b9d0).  The test pattern exposes
    problems in the apply.c changes currently in the proposed updates
    branch.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  3. Add a link from update-server-info documentation to repository layout.

    Junio C Hamano authored
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  4. [PATCH] Make git-apply understand incomplete lines in non-C locales

    Fredrik Kuivinen authored Junio C Hamano committed
    The message "\ No newline at end of file" used by diff(1) to mark
    an incomplete line is locale dependent. We can't assume more than
    that it begins with "\ ".
    
    For example, given two files, "foo" and "bar", with appropriate
    contents, 'diff -u foo bar' will produce the following output on
    my system:
    
        --- foo 2005-09-04 18:59:38.000000000 +0200
        +++ bar 2005-09-04 18:59:16.000000000 +0200
        @@ -1 +1 @@
        -foobar
        +foo
        \ Ingen nyrad vid filslut
    
    [jc: the check for the marker still uses the line length being no less
    than 12 bytes for a sanity check, but I think it is safe to assume
    that in other locales. I haven't checked the .po files from diff, tho'.]
    
    Signed-off-by: Fredrik Kuivinen <freku045@student.liu.se>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  5. git-applymbox: fix '-c'.

    Junio C Hamano authored
    Earlier round b50abe8 broke it
    by carelessly rewriting the main loop.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  6. [PATCH] archimport: avoid committing on an Arch tag

    Martin Langhoff authored Junio C Hamano committed
    Arch tags are full commits (without any changed files) as well. Trust Arch
    to have put an unchanged tree in place (which seems to do reliably), and
    just add a tag & new branch. Speeds up Arch imports significantly, and leaves
    history in a much saner state.
    
    Signed-off-by: Martin Langhoff <martin@catalyst.net.nz>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  7. [PATCH] archimport autodetects import status, supports incremental im…

    Martin Langhoff authored Junio C Hamano committed
    …ports
    
    If there is no GIT directory, archimport will assume it is an initial import.
    
    It now also supports incremental imports,  skipping "seen" commits. You can
    now run it repeatedly to pull new commits from the Arch repository.
    
    Signed-off-by: Martin Langhoff <martin@catalyst.net.nz>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  8. @sigprof

    [PATCH] NUL terminate the object data in patch_delta()

    sigprof authored Junio C Hamano committed
    At least pretty_print_commit() expects to get NUL-terminated commit data to
    work properly.  unpack_sha1_rest(), which reads objects from separate files,
    and unpack_non_delta_entry(), which reads non-delta-compressed objects from
    pack files, already add the NUL byte after the object data, but patch_delta()
    did not do it, which caused problems with, e.g., git-rev-list --pretty when
    there are delta-compressed commit objects.
    
    Signed-off-by: Sergey Vlasov <vsu@altlinux.ru>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  9. [PATCH] Possible cleanups for local-pull.c

    Peter Hagervall authored Junio C Hamano committed
    Hi. This patch contains the following possible cleanups:
    
     * Make some needlessly global functions in local-pull.c static
     * Change 'char *' to 'const char *' where appropriate
    
    Signed-off-by: Peter Hagervall <hager@cs.umu.se>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  10. [PATCH] Doc: replace read-cache with git-read-tree.

    Paolo 'Blaisorblade' Giarrusso authored Junio C Hamano committed
    Replace references to "read-cache" with references to git-read-tree in the
    documentation. I chose that because reference say "see read-cache about
    stages", and stages are explained in git-read-tree.
    
    Signed-off-by: Paolo 'Blaisorblade' Giarrusso <blaisorblade@yahoo.it>
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Commits on Sep 3, 2005
  1. Document hooks.

    Junio C Hamano authored
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Commits on Sep 2, 2005
  1. Merge branch 'master' of .

    Junio C Hamano authored
  2. Mention post-update when we first talk about publishing a repository.

    Junio C Hamano authored
    There is more detailed instruction for `project lead` later in
    the tutorial to talk about the same, but at this point in the
    flow of tutorial, the first time reader has no way of knowing it.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  3. scripts: equality test '==' is not portable.

    Junio C Hamano authored
    On NetBSD 3 we trigger an error:
    
        [: ==: unexpected operator
    
    Double-equal is accepted by bash built-in '[' and bash(1) suggests
    using '=' for strict POSIX compliance (test(1) from coreutils does not
    mention '==').  Eradicate their uses everywhere.
    
    [jc: Somebody with a pseudonym kindly sent a message to let
     me know about the problem privately; I do not have access to a NetBSD
     box.]
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  4. git-checkout-script: Remove unnecessary variable.

    Junio C Hamano authored
    There was unused variable $i that counted the number of arguments
    being processed.  Remove it.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
  5. Fix automerge message.

    Junio C Hamano authored
    The rewrite done while adding the shorthand support made the remote
    refname recorded in the commit message too long for human consumption,
    while losing information by using the shorthand not the real URL to
    name the remote repository there.  They were both bad changes done
    without enough thinking.
    
    Pointed out by Linus.
    
    Signed-off-by: Junio C Hamano <junkio@cox.net>
Something went wrong with that request. Please try again.